Belarus: extended detention arrested anarchists in the autumn

According to the portal on January 21 it became known that the term of Nicholas Dedkov extended until March 6, and the term of investigation on his case - until April 9. Igor Olinevichu, Maxim Vetkin and Alexander Frantskevich period of detention was extended until April. In Moscow on 28 November by unknown assailants in civilian clothes had kidnapped Igor Olinevich. Contrary to international law is November 29 Olinevich was brought to the prison of the KGB, where he resides to this day. Information on his whereabouts had been received from his mother, with whom Igor has contacted provided a lawyer.

Just only in late November found a lawyer Maxim Vetkin. Because of the "features" of the case, many lawyers refused to take up for him, fearing for his future career.

Nicholas Dedkov October 1, was charged with st.339 Part 2. to participate in . Cops are already more than a month does not allow his father to meet him, arguing that it "may damage the investigation."

Nicholas, you can write a letter of support at 222160, wasZhodino, Minsk region. Str. Soviet 22a prison № 8, Dedkov Nikolai Alexandrovich.

According to available information, Alexander Frantskevich Sept. 20 was formally charged in attack on police station in Soligorsk. Investigators do not allow the mother of Alexander to meet with him to provide the date they agreed only in exchange for "valuable evidence."

Alexander, you can write a letter of support at the address Minsk, 220050, st. Volodarsky 2 jail 1, room46, Frantskevich Alexander

Maxim Vetkin is in jail on ul.Volodarskogo, and he was indicted on st.339 Part 2 (Disorder). He is accused of involvement in the incident near the Russian Embassy 30/8/1910

Igor Olinevich located in the KGB jail. Its also accused of involvement in the incident near the Russian embassy 08/30/1910. You can write to Igor at: Olinevichu Igor Vladimirovich PO Box 8, General Post Office, 220050 Minsk, Belarus

Warning: Arrested letters often do not reach. So all letters are read by the censors, so consider this when writing!

Also during the autumn there was a series of searches and interrogations in Minsk, Gomel, Grodno, Salihorsk, Brest, Bobruisk and Novopolotsk.In total, questioned several dozen people from the informal clubbers to football fans and activists in environmental initiatives. Investigators are interested in terms of communicating interrogation (including information about telephone conversations), asked to identify people in photographs from the concerts in Minsk - actively persuaded to give evidence against Nicholas Dedkov.
